FIA seeking new F1 team
The FIA has opened the tender process for a new team to join the F1 grid from as early as next season. Citing 'due regard for the sustainability and future success of the Formula One World Championship', the sport's governing body is looking for a new team to enter the championship at either the start of the 2016 or 2017 season. After the demise of Caterham over the winter, the grid consists of just 10 teams in 2015 – although Haas F1 are gearing up to make their F1 debut next year after coming through the FIA's previous tender process in 2013-14.
